Why Industry Super Funds Continue to Deliver

Industry super funds have long been lauded for their ability to generate consistent returns, and the latest data from NGS adds to a growing body of evidence supporting this reputation. Several factors contribute to their ongoing success:

  • Long-term investment horizons: Unlike retail funds that may chase quarterly results, industry funds focus on multi-decade strategies that smooth out market volatility.
  • Lower fees: By operating on a not-for-profit basis, industry funds keep costs down, allowing more of the investment returns to flow directly to members.
  • Diversified portfolios: These funds typically hold a broad mix of assets, including equities, property, infrastructure, and alternative investments, which helps mitigate risk.
  • Member-centric governance: With boards that include equal representation from employers and unions, decisions are made with the best interests of members at heart.

This combination of factors has enabled funds like NGS to deliver returns that consistently beat the system average, providing members with a more secure financial future.

Implications for Members and the Broader Economy

For NGS members, the strong returns translate directly into larger retirement balances, which can make a significant difference in their quality of life post-retirement. The compounding effect of consistent returns over time cannot be overstated, and members who remain invested through market cycles are typically rewarded with superior outcomes.

Beyond individual benefits, the success of industry super funds also has broader economic implications. These funds are major investors in Australian infrastructure and corporate debt, providing essential capital for economic growth. By generating strong returns, NGS and its peers are not only securing the financial futures of their members but also contributing to the overall health of the national economy.
